As such, practitioners use it for many of the same reasons and according to the same principles as acupuncture. Like acupuncture , TCM uses tui na to harmonize yin and yang in the body by manipulating the Qi in the acupuncture channels. Tui na includes what is popularly known as "acupressure," where practitioners use finger pressure instead of needles to stimulate the acupuncture points. Tui na is one of the most popular TCM treatment modalities and is frequently used in the treatment of superficial trauma and injury and a wide variety of musculoskeletal problems.

Traditional Chinese Medicine philosophy treats patients holistically, focusing on physical, mental, and spiritual wellness.
Tui Na is intended to restore physiological and emotional balance by unblocking channels of qi through the body that have been blocked by tension, bad habits, and poor health. One study shows that Tui Na massage is a welcome relief for those with chronic neck pain.
